About 24 Bankside
24 Bankside is a two-bedroom mid-terrace house in Blackburn (BB2 3TB). It has a recorded floor area of 61 m² (around 657 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1983-1990 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(February 2017) shows a C (score 71). The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 89).
It hasn't traded since July 2006, a hold of 20 years that's notably long for the area. Across 1997–2006, sale prices on this property compounded at 9.4%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£130,000 sits 56.6% above the 2006 sale of £83,000. At 61 m² it's 18.4% larger than the typical home in the postcode (52 m² median across 12 EPCs).
